Back in the 80s, it seemed "deep curl" blackbucks were all the rage. The Texas Exotics Record book used a measurement that went along the outside the curl to get length. Maybe it's just me, but it seems in the past 5-10 yrs or so, I'm seeing a lot more basically straight horn BB with little no curl and most folks now refer to the straight tape measurement system. It would make sense if the straighter horn BB were now preferred as breeders bc the deep curl BB don't straight line measure as long. Am I off my rocker here?

5 curl+ blackbuck are still the rage and bring the most $$...in Texas, there are numerous scoring/record systems. SCI, which is really the only one that really matters, still measures around the curls. Go for the ones with curls! The 5 curl blackbuck that was a monster at the YO sale a couple of years ago went for around $6,500.
